Output 587ca6af78a00569e9162ecd5f62a88116027bdb9ecba1bcbee24f7c875ea7a3:1

value
539564860
script pubkey
OP_0 OP_PUSHBYTES_20 6cdfe5fb0e5aa97ccbc7a20a7d373cfe0855dba4
address
ltc1qdn07t7cwt25hej785g986deulcy9tkaynhytcg
transaction
587ca6af78a00569e9162ecd5f62a88116027bdb9ecba1bcbee24f7c875ea7a3
spent
true